(Image courtesy of Mitchell Lazar) The latest NIEHS Differentiated Sermon focused on just how a microorganism's biological rhythms, or even the physical procedures that on a regular basis transform based upon a 24-hour duration, impact metabolism.Mitchell Lazar, M.D., Ph.D., the Willard as well as Rhoda Materials Professor in Diabetes Mellitus as well as Metabolic Ailments at the College of Pennsylvania Perelman Institution of Medicine, provided 'Nuclear Receptors, Biological Rhythms, as well as Rate Of Metabolism' Oct. thirteen utilizing the Zoom platform.Two nuclear receptors, Rev-erb and also PPARgamma, go to the center of Lazar's study. Nuclear receptors are actually healthy proteins that bind to DNA and also moderate cellular processes.The initial portion of his talk paid attention to the liver, genes that regulate cell time clocks, and Rev-erb, a receptor he found.' The liver's clockCircadian rhythms are actually produced through an organism's body clocks. The mind has the central clock, which integrates the other clock genetics that show up in practically every cell in the body system. Lazar pays attention to clock genetics in the liver due to the fact that diet-induced obesity adjustments how the healthy proteins made from these genes work, which has a bearing on metabolism.Hepatocytes make up around 80% of the tissues in the liver and are in charge of the significant features of the organ, making bile, making healthy proteins, and purifying the body system. The liver additionally contains stem tissues, invulnerable tissues called Kupffer tissues, and also endothelial tissues. Lazar preserves that a number of challenge pieces come together to affect biological rhythms as well as metabolic rate. (Image courtesy of Mitchell Lazar) Lazar knocked senseless Rev-erb in the hepatocytes of one group of mice as well as contrasted their gene expression or healthy protein development to control mice hepatocytes that had Rev-erb. He was amazed to find that knockout mice exhibited genetics expression improvements in non-hepatocytes, like Kupffer cells.' The hepatocyte clock manages both the hepatocyte as well as non-hepatocyte circadian rhythms as well as metabolic process,' Lazar said.Path towards personalized medicineHe next discussed PPARgamma, the atomic receptor required to help make body fat tissues perform effectively. Lazar clarified that anomalies in PPARgamma can easily result in lipodystrophy, or even the abnormal circulation of fat in the physical body, and also insulin-resistant diabetes.Several years back, pharmaceutical companies began searching for substances that will bind to PPARgamma in chance of discovering a diabetes mellitus medicine. Some of the molecules that supported the best guarantee was actually rosiglitazone. Although it dramatically boosted insulin protection, it carried out not decrease the risk of heart attack and stroke, partially as a result of its undesirable effect of raising cholesterol levels levels.Lazar as well as his crew identified that a specific tiny distinction in the genome, referred to as a singular nucleotide polymorphism, was actually a hereditary factor of whether a given client would certainly experience the excess side effect of rosiglitazone. Succeeding studies showed the speculation correct (observe sidebar).' My recommendation is this example is actually generalizable to other nuclear receptors, like corticoids and also estrogens and others, however maybe for all drugs that function as transcription factors,' Lazar stated. 'It's a pathway towards customizing medication, in this particular case, based on a basic know-how of genomics as well as organic mechanisms.'.
